英文摘要
Organ ischemia-reperfusion injury in a living body, greatly changed the life prognosis. The studies were conducted with a focus on the renal protective effect of hydrogen as an agent with the organ protective effects. Use the Wistar rat, anesthesia enforcement, make tracheal intubation, artificial respiration, after exposure to the kidney on both sides side abdominal incision, to clamp en bloc renal artery, renal vein, ureter. Ischemic time is 40 minutes. Administration of hydrogen was performed by dividing the low concentration and high concentration group. After that, I closed the wound. Blood samples were collected after 24 hours, and measured blood urea nitrogen, and creatinine. By hydrogen administration, increased blood urea nitrogen, creatinine can be suppressed has been found.
